Enterprise Network Outsourcing: A Competitive Landscape in TransitionProduct Type: Market Research ReportPublished by: IDC Published: August 2006 Product Code: R104-27261 Description
This IDC study provides insight into the changing competitive dynamics of the market for network outsourcing. "At IDC, we believe that manner in which network services are delivered to enterprises will experience dramatic changes in the next few years. These changes in service delivery models will transcend technology and impact the very manner in which companies compete. It is essential that companies have the strategic foresight to understand these changes and their competitive implications." - Sean Hackett, research manager, Business Network Services Table of Contents
